What are mold parts?

A mold is more than a hollow shape. It is a carefully engineered system of components working together. Each part has a specific function. The cavity defines the shape. How Does 3D Printing Work Exactly?

Introduction You have seen the videos. A machine hums. A nozzle moves back and forth. Layer by layer, an object rises from nothing. This is 3D printing. It is also called additive manufacturing. Unlike traditional methods that cut away material, 3D printing builds objects from the ground up. It adds material where it is needed.
